About this activity
Situated 160km south of the equator, Nairobi is a modern, cosmopolitan city with regional headquarters for many African and Indian Ocean businesses. With delegates attracted here from around the world, they come for the friendliness of the people, the modern hotel facilities and the vast array of fascinating options available throughout the city. Although the ‘City in the Sun’ is relatively young by global standards, it has a fascinating history capturing explorers, missionaries, wars, cultural diversity and politics , each leaving their mark on the city in some way.
The Carnivore Restaurant is one of Africa’s greatest eating experiences, made famous for its succulent steaks, barbecue dishes, game meat and great African hospitality. A visit here is an excellent complement to a holiday and makes a perfect spot for meals with an African buzz. Delicious barbequed and skewered vegetarian meals are also available.
Following lunch, head out of town to the suburb of Karen, with the Ngong Hills as a backdrop. The old colonial farmhouse is simple, housing a few items that Karen Blixen chose and once enjoyed herself. There is also the colourful garden to explore, where several old coffee machines have lain untouched for decades.
From here visit the Giraffe Centre then you will be dropped off at your hotel or the city centre late afternoon.
